Challenges Hospitality Businesses Face

  • Delivery Commissions

    Third party apps take a cut of every order and keep the customer relationship.

  • Menus Out of Step

    The same dish priced differently on the website, the delivery apps and the till.

  • Phone Order Chaos

    Orders taken by phone during service, written down and sometimes misheard.

  • No Guest Records

    No record of who ordered what, so there is nothing to build repeat visits on.

  • Reservation No-Shows

    Tables held for bookings that never arrive, with no reminder having gone out.

  • Manual Reporting

    Sales pulled from separate systems by hand before anyone can compare sites.

Common Questions

Hospitality Software Questions, Answered

Can we take online orders without paying a commission?

Yes. An ordering channel under your own brand costs a card processing fee and a hosting cost rather than a percentage of every order. It will not replace the delivery apps immediately, because they bring discovery you do not have. What it does is give your regulars a direct route and give you the customer record that the apps keep.

Will it work with the POS we already have on the floor?

Usually. We start from what your till exposes, whether that is an API, a middleware connector or a supported export, and design around it rather than asking you to change a system your staff already know. Where a POS offers no safe route in, we say so early and set out what that means for menu syncing.

How do we stop prices drifting between the menu and the till?

By making one system the source for menu and price, then having everything else read from it. Which system holds that role depends on how you already work, and agreeing it first is the whole job. Getting that decision wrong is the usual reason a guest is quoted one price online and charged another at the counter.

Can this be set up without disrupting service?

That is the constraint we plan around. Changes go in between services, never mid-shift, and anything touching ordering or the till gets a rehearsal on a quiet day before it is live on a Friday. We also agree a rollback that a manager can trigger without calling us.

We have several sites that price differently. Does that work?

Yes, and it is the normal case rather than the exception. Menus and prices are held centrally with per-site overrides, so a downtown location can charge what it needs to without head office rebuilding the menu. Managers get the specific permissions you want them to have, and changes are logged by site.

How much training will floor and kitchen staff need?

Not much if the screens match how service already runs, which is why we design them with the people working the floor. Turnover in this sector is high, so we record a short walkthrough that a new starter can watch rather than relying on one manager to teach everybody.

Who owns the customer data from online orders?

You do. That is most of the argument for running your own channel. Guest records, order history and marketing consent sit in your system, so you can run a reorder prompt or a slow Tuesday offer without asking a platform for permission or paying for the privilege of contacting your own customers.

What support is there once we are live?

A support arrangement covering fixes, updates and small changes, with cover that matches service hours rather than office hours. A problem at seven on a Friday is not the same as a problem at ten on a Tuesday, and the arrangement should reflect that.
